About The Role
The primary objective is to reduce / eliminate environmental liability by ensuring the plant is operating with the requirements of the permit, regulation and the law. The incumbent will deliver the elements of the environmental management system such as ensuring audits are completed; follow up actions are completed and provide supporting on administrative duties necessary for compliance. In addition, the Environment Coordinator, works with various other departments and Country level staff to advance Lafarge Canada’s sustainability goals (decarbonization, circularity, water & nature, and people and communities) and develop long-term improvements as well as working to ensure that the Lafarge technical doctrines are implemented at the plant level.
What You’ll Accomplish
- Follows and ensures full compliance with Health & Safety policies and procedures.
- Ensures all contracts and project site meet the Lafarge safety policy requirements for our employee’s safety.
- Develop, circulate and update Standard Operating Procedures (SOP) to control the impacts of plant activity on the environment
- Identify environmental hazards and propose preventative measures
- Develop and update an emergency and communication plan in the event of an environmental incident
- Implement the means needed to minimize, recycle and treat waste generated by the plant
- Work with project stakeholders to prepare environmental documents and related technical studies
- Set environmental department long, medium and short term goals and objectives in line with country, market and plant objectives
- Manage all compliance reporting requirements within the Eastern Canada Region, including both internal and external regulatory reporting requirements.
- Demonstrate a commitment to communicating, improving and adhering to health, safety and environmental policies in all work environments and areas. Promote a culture of safety and exhibit these behaviours.
